Record view numerous takes with a supervisor directing your ability. Guarantee you have enough coverage and several great takes of each line. When it comes to manufacturing, toenailing your shots is crucial. You don't intend to be stuck having to reshoot because you didn't get enough great takes of each line.


As a supervisor, Chris likes to get at the very least two really great takes of each and every single line before going right into the edit. When we worked on the Welcome to Wistia job, we set apart three days for production, but only two for actually shooting around the workplace. Why two days, you ask? Well, our workplace had not been specifically camera-ready.


You merely could not throw up an electronic camera and begin capturing. Remember, we wanted our videos to be glossy, so we needed to be very willful with our set layout, props, lighting, and whatever that comprised the shot. Providing on your own enough time during manufacturing is important to ensuring your shots are area on.
